Miyajima is located near Hiroshima, requiring less than 30 min by train, followed by a 10-min ferry ride. It is a very beautiful island that is worth visiting, and it would be preferable to stay one night on the island.
I would recommend the following attractions on the island:
Itsukushima Shrine, which is famous for its distinctive floating torii gate. It is a UNESCO World Heritage Site, and is one of the most iconic images of traditional Japan. This a torii gate like no other in Japan, and is a great photo taking spot.
Mount Misen is the highest peak on the island, and is 535m high. I took the 2-way ropeway (2,000 yen/pax) up and down the mountain, though there is a hiking option as well. Even with the ropeway, there is a 30-min climb to the summit, which is well worth the hike due to the amazing views from the top.
Miyajima is famous for its oysters and eels. We had lunch at Mametanuki, which serves affordable lunch sets at around 3,000 yen each.
